  • Estate Planning Trusts: A Key Tool for Wealth Preservation and Transfer

    Estate planning is an important aspect of personal finance that most people tend to put off. However, failure to plan can lead to legal disputes and financial difficulties for your loved ones in the event of your death. Trusts are among the most powerful tools for estate planning. They enable you to transfer your assets to your family or chosen beneficiaries while concurrently minimizing estate taxes and ensuring efficient asset management. [Read More]
